Understanding Casement Windows
Casement windows are depended upon one side and open outside, supplying ample ventilation. They are typically operated with a crank mechanism, permitting smooth opening and closing. This style produces an airtight seal when closed, adding to energy efficiency. Casement windows are available in different styles, products, and sizes to fit different architectural visual appeals.
